Amazon is looking for a motivated individual for the profile of ACES (Amazon Customer Excellence Systems) Program Manager III for its MEATR operations team. The candidate should enjoy getting their hands dirty, working on the floor for conducting time and motion studies and analysis and looking around the corners for solutions with the aim of optimization of cost and productivity in Amazon Rush last mile delivery stations.
As an ACES (Amazon Customer Excellence Systems) program manager III, you will be the subject matter expert for Rush operations driving cost optimization for UAE operations in addition to supporting network speed and DEX projects.
You will be a subject matter expert on Rush operations and tools focusing on safety, quality, productivity, and delivery associate experience agenda as well as network speed projects. You should be able to think big to solve complex problems with simple and practical solutions by developing a deep knowledge of the operation processes, Amazon’s UTR, OTR and routing technologies.
This role calls for an individual who can own all aspects of how transportation impacts customer experience, and operator experience; monitor metrics, determine, then drive any initiatives necessary to improve it. It requires an individual to showcase judgement and decision-making skills to balance customer experience with financial impact. This position offers a broad exposure to various business, financial, and technical teams within Amazon.
The successful candidate will be a person who enjoys and excels at dealing with ambiguity and design and define products/programs with little information. He / She will have excellent written and verbal communication skills, the ability to create and sustain urgency, and a proven ability to lead cross-functional projects including communication across all levels and teams in the organization: senior leaders, technical teams, finance, business, and operations leaders.
